Williston Park wildfire risk explained

Moderate
28thpercentile nationally

Williston Park sits at the 28th percentile nationally for wildfire risk to structures — close to the middle of USFS's national wildfire-risk range — per USFS's Wildfire Risk to Communities model, built from its 2,725 counted buildings, not vegetation cover alone. (Source: USFS's Wildfire Risk to Communities methodology.)

Fire likelihood alone (USFS's burn-probability figure) ranks Williston Park at the 31st national percentile — 4 points above its risk-to-structures score, a gap driven by how much is actually built there.

How Williston Park compares

Williston Park's 57th-percentile standing inside New York outpaces its 28th national percentile — this is a hotter spot than most of its own state, even though the state as a whole runs cooler nationally. Among the 31,521 US communities USFS scores, Williston Park ranks 22,856 for wildfire risk (1 is highest) and 5,889 by building count (1 is largest).
